diff --git a/src/main/frontend/format/mldoc.cljs b/src/main/frontend/format/mldoc.cljs index 61e7c44c73..9961f124ef 100644 --- a/src/main/frontend/format/mldoc.cljs +++ b/src/main/frontend/format/mldoc.cljs @@ -263,4 +263,6 @@ (defn link? [format link] (when (string? link) - (= "Link" (ffirst (inline->edn link (default-config format)))))) + (let [[type link] (first (inline->edn link (default-config format)))] + (and (= "Link" type) + (not (contains? #{"Page_ref" "Block_ref"} (first (:url link)))))))) diff --git a/src/test/frontend/format/mldoc-test.cljs b/src/test/frontend/format/mldoc_test.cljs similarity index 100% rename from src/test/frontend/format/mldoc-test.cljs rename to src/test/frontend/format/mldoc_test.cljs